Dojo Madness GmbH

Series A in 2017
Dojo Madness GmbH develops a set of tools that helps gamers to master their play. The company offers LOLSumo, an Android and iOS based real-time virtual coaching application for League of Legends that enables gamers to build orders and crucial information about their match; OVERSUMO, an overmatches virtual coach, which features detailed performance analysis, gameplay tips, and hero guides; DOTASUMO, a virtual coach for DOTA 2 players seeking to improve their game. It offers post-game insights, and enables users to analyze and improve his or her gameplay; and Shadow.GG, a SaaS platform providing analytics and data visualizations for Counter-Strike. It also offers BRUCE.GG, a platform that allows gamers to get their own plays as videos, share them with their friends, rate their clips, and coach each other with its tools; and offers automatically generated top scenes, match analysis, and tactical insight for coaching. The company was founded in 2014 and is based in Berlin, Germany.

Gamezop

Series A in 2020
Gamezop develops HTML5 games. HTML5 games do not have to be installed as apps and are not tied to any particular operating system (i.e. these games work across Android, iOS, Windows, etc.). These games are device-agnostic as well and can run on feature phones, smartphones, desktops, smart TVs, in-flight entertainment systems, etc. The company leverages the distribution network of various messengers, browsers, entertainment apps, telecom operators, and gaming websites to publish its games. These distribution partners get access to a rich product suite (APIs, SDKs, white-labeled PWA, bots, revenue, and analytics dashboard) during and after integration with Gamezop.
